摘要:

[目的/意义] 提出基于高被引论文的期刊热点指数评价指标和方法,揭示学术期刊在领域研究热点中的作用与贡献,促进学术期刊的多元化评价,为期刊评价提供新的观察视角和有益补充。 [方法/过程] 基于期刊对高被引论文的参与和引用情况,构建期刊的热点引领度和热点吸收度两个测度指标,由此建立象限图进行分类评价。以ESI农业科学领域期刊进行实证研究,探讨期刊热点指数与期刊传统计量指标之间的相关性。 [结果/结论] 期刊热点指数对期刊具有较好的区分度和辨识度,能够在一定程度上与现有期刊评价指标形成互补,识别出在领域研究热点发展中起到关键作用的期刊。期刊热点指数作为期刊评价指标体系的有益补充,从新的分析视角观察期刊发展状况和质量水平,有利于对期刊进行更为全面精确的评价与定位,为中国期刊发展和建设方向提供参考。

Abstract:

[Purpose/Significance] To promote the development of world-class scientific journals, it is necessary for journals to enhance their understanding of the evolving trends in scientific frontiers and research hotspots. Therefore, characterizing the participation and functional role of journals in research hotspots from the perspective of the journals themselves is of great significance for advancingg journal evaluation theory and promoting discipline development, and journal construction. Relatively little existing research has addressed the role of journals in forming research hotspots within disciplines. It is difficult to reveal the functional differences between journals in the formation and evolution of research hotspots. This study proposed a journal hotspot index evaluation and method based on highly cited papers, revealing the role and function of academic journals in research hotspots in the field, promoting the diversified evaluation of academic journals, and providing a new perspective and useful supplement to journal evaluation. [Methods/Process] Highly cited papers are often concentrated on research topics that have received high attention and continuous discussion in the academic community within a specific period. Their concentrated appearance usually corresponds to the formation of research hotspots or important theoretical progress. Based on the participation and citation of highly cited papers by journals, this study constructed two measurement indicators: the journal's hotspot leadership and hotspot absorption. Based on this, a quadrant diagram was established to classify and evaluate four different types of journal sets, revealing their distribution characteristics and patterns. This study used ESI agricultural science journals as an example to explore the correlation between the journal hotspot index and traditional journal metrics. [Results/Conclusions] The journal hotspot index demonstrates good discriminatory and identifiable characteristics, complementing existing journal evaluation metrics to some extent and identifying journals playing a key role in the development of research hotspots in the field. As a valuable supplement to the journal evaluation index system, the journal hotspot index offers a new analytical perspective on journal development and quality levels, facilitating a more comprehensive and accurate evaluation and positioning of journals, and providing a reference for the development and construction direction of journals in my country. However, the index system still has certain limitations, mainly in the time window for highly cited papers and its adaptability to different subject areas. Future research could expand into more subject areas to further verify the interdisciplinary applicability of this method. Furthermore, we will consider introducing more dynamic window mechanisms to enhance the index's adaptability to emerging disciplines and journals, thereby improving the universality and explanatory power of the journal hotspot index.
